My 9-5 was tested yesterday for rear impact...

While stopped for road work a young kid in a beat up plymouth decided to save his break pads by using my rear to come to a complete stop. My meticulously maintained 2.3lpt is now off to get repaired. I am waiting to see what exactly needs to be done. The lower rear bumper was mostly hit on the driver side which more or less is pushed down and to the left. The trunk lid and tail lights were untouched. My park assist still works fine. However, it appears that there is a give now in the upper part of the driver side rear quarter panel. I think it took the energy of the impact. From the look of it nothing appears to be greatly damaged, just cosmetics.
I guess my question is (of course without seeing it and my mediocre description) could the integrity of that side of the car be compromised in any way? I was hit good but not severly.
I am very impressed with how the car handled the impact. It's a 2003 and I believe it has one of the highest safety ratings. I was kept snug in my seat and for a moment I felt like I was in a tank. I just wish I could take the Saab's word for how safe they are and not experience it.
